    1. Yes, it doesn't look like it's coming out in Canada anytime soon.

    2. Screen is adequate, my biggest peeve with it is the viewing angle.

    3. Pretty sure you can return it to PCHome and get your full money back including shipping. If it's something small you can take it to any computer repair shop, if it's something major you might have to ship it back to Taiwan for them to do work on it.

    4. No CD drive, yes you can make ISOs (in another computer) or get an external DVD drive that attaches via USB. You will want to make a bootable USB stick of Windows 7 if you want a clean install, follow Bronsky's guide.

    5. Yes, make sure you get Home Premium. You can also not reformat and just download a language pack to make it in English.

    Peter was correct about his warnings on Vistalizator, a program that Lastdon was kind enough to bring to our attention.

    Using it to change your Windows OS from its default language to one of your choosing will render your OS as non-genuine when performing CERTAIN tasks.

    Apparently, The program does its thing by changing core files that WAT depends on for validation. When WAT attempts to verify the hash signature and can't base the native language of the SKU, it flags the system and places it in notification mode. While in this mode, no functionality is removed from Windows. However, the desktop will turn black and you will receive notifications when starting the computer, performing certain tasks. In addition, you might not be unable to download certain MS applications and MSE may or may not work

    The good news is that this situation is reversible, thanks to a special software program. The bad news is that you need to contact Microsoft Assisted Support to get it. Granted it's not totally bad news, but it's a hassle nonetheless.
